Installation requirements of Advanced EPDR for macOS platforms

Supported Operating Systems_
- Refer to this chart to find out if your macOs version supports the installation of Panda Endpoint protection. To know what Panda for macOS protection version you have installed, see this article.
MacOS Version Panda Endpoint Protection Version macOS 15 Sequoia Supported from v3.05.00.0001 macOS 14 Sonoma Supported from v3.03.00.0002 macOS 13 Ventura Supported from v3.02.00.0000 macOS 12 Monterey Supported from v3.00.00.0000 macOS 11 Big Sur Supported from v3.00.00.0000 macOS 10.15 Catalina Supported from v3.00.00.0000 macOS 10.14 Mojave Supported until v2.00.10.0000 macOS 10.13 High Sierra Supported until v2.00.10.0000 macOS 10.12 Sierra Supported until v2.00.10.0000 macOS 10.11 El Capitan Supported until v2.00.10.0000 macOS 10.10 Yosemite Supported until v2.00.10.0000
Hardware Requirements_
-
Processor Intel Core 2 Duo RAM Memory 2 GB Free space in disk 400 MB Ports 3127, 3128, 3129 and 8310 must be accessible for the web anti-malware and URL filtering to work.
Permissions Requirements_
To ensure the correct functioning of the Panda protection in macOS, you must enable these permissions required by Apple:
- System Extension and Login Item for EndpointProtectionService
- Full Disk Access for Protection Agent
- NextLoader for Network Extension

Time Synchronization of Computers (NTP)_
Although not an essential requirement, we recommend that the clocks on computers protected by Advanced EPDR/EDR be synchronized. This synchronization is normally achieved using an NTP server.
HTTPS Inspection Network Ranges_
If the computer where you want to install the Panda Endpoint protection is monitored by a proxy or firewall with HTTPS inspection, you must add these network ranges to the HTTPS protocol:
- 17.248.128.0/18
- 17.250.64.0/18
- 17.248.192.0/19
